Remoteaddrvalve

Posted onby admin
  1. Remoteaddrvalve Tomcat
  2. Remoteaddrvalve Tomcat 8
  3. Remoteaddrvalve Example
Remoteaddrvalve

Remoteaddrvalve Tomcat

Concrete implementation of RequestFilterValve that filters based on the string representation of the remote client's IP address.

Remoteaddrvalve Tomcat 8

Version:
$Revision: 515 $ $Date: 2008-03-17 22:02:23 +0100 (Mon, 17 Mar 2008) $
Author:
Craig R. McClanahan

Server Configurations. The JBoss EAP 7 server configurations design is the same used by JBoss EAP 6: single XML file configurations to use JBoss EAP as a standalone server, which by default may be found in each server’s directory standalone/configurations, and single XML file configurations to use JBoss EAP as a host in a managed domain, which by default may be found in each server’s. Would allow access to all computers in that range. The list can also contain additional IP addresses and ranges via comma separated values. I looked at the javadocs for the RemoteAddrValve and they provided no further clarity on the syntax issue. You're right, my test case mistakenly returned a false positive, '.' could match anything its true and their is no 'common sense' wildcard in the Java Regex package. I looked at the javadoc for the regex package and found it a.

Field Summary
Remoteaddrvalve
Fields inherited from class org.apache.catalina.valves.RequestFilterValve
allow, allows, denies, deny, sm
Fields inherited from class org.apache.catalina.valves.ValveBase
container, containerLog, controller, domain, mserver, next, oname
Constructor Summary
RemoteAddrValve()
Method Summary
java.lang.StringgetInfo()
Return descriptive information about this Valve implementation.
voidinvoke(Request request, Response response)
Extract the desired request property, and pass it (along with the specified request and response objects) to the protected process() method to perform the actual filtering.
Methods inherited from class org.apache.catalina.valves.RequestFilterValve
getAllow, getDeny, precalculate, process, setAllow, setDeny
Methods inherited from class org.apache.catalina.valves.ValveBase
backgroundProcess, createObjectName, event, getContainer, getContainerName, getController, getDomain, getNext, getObjectName, getParentName, postDeregister, postRegister, preDeregister, preRegister, setContainer, setController, setNext, setObjectName, toString
Methods inherited from class java.lang.Object
clone, equals, finalize, getClass, hashCode, notify, notifyAll, wait, wait, wait
Remoteaddrvalve

Remoteaddrvalve Example

Constructor Detail

RemoteAddrValve

Method Detail

getInfo

Return descriptive information about this Valve implementation.
Specified by:
getInfo in interface Valve
Overrides:
getInfo in class RequestFilterValve
Remoteaddrvalve

invoke

Remoteaddrvalve
Extract the desired request property, and pass it (along with the specified request and response objects) to the protected process() method to perform the actual filtering. This method must be implemented by a concrete subclass.
Specified by:
invoke in interface Valve
Specified by:
invoke in class RequestFilterValve
Parameters:
request - The servlet request to be processed
response - The servlet response to be created
Throws:
java.io.IOException - if an input/output error occurs
javax.servlet.ServletException - if a servlet error occurs
OverviewPackageClassTreeDeprecatedIndexHelp
FRAMESNO FRAMESAll Classes SUMMARY: NESTED FIELD CONSTR METHODDETAIL: FIELD CONSTR METHODCopyright © 2000-2008 Apache Software Foundation. All Rights Reserved.